Maximizing Your Retirement: Essential Pension Investment Advice

As you approach retirement, one of the most crucial factors to consider is how your pension funds are being invested. Proper pension investment is essential for ensuring a comfortable and secure financial future. Without careful planning and strategic decision-making, you run the risk of outliving your savings or not being able to maintain the lifestyle you desire during your golden years.

Here are some key pieces of pension investment advice to help you make the most of your retirement savings:

1. Start Early and Contribute Regularly
One of the most effective ways to maximize your pension funds is to start contributing as early as possible. The power of compounding means that the earlier you start investing, the more time your money has to grow. Even small contributions made regularly can add up significantly over time. If you haven’t started investing in your pension yet, don’t delay any further. The sooner you begin, the better off you will be in the long run.

2. Diversify Your Investments
Diversification is a fundamental principle of investing that can help protect your pension funds from market volatility. By spreading your investments across different asset classes such as stocks, bonds, and real estate, you can reduce risk and potential losses. Make sure to review and adjust your portfolio regularly to ensure it remains diversified and aligned with your retirement goals.

3. Consider Your Risk Tolerance
When investing your pension funds, it’s crucial to consider your risk tolerance. While higher risk investments may offer the potential for greater returns, they also come with increased volatility and the risk of losing money. Your risk tolerance will depend on various factors such as your age, financial goals, and comfort level with market fluctuations. Working with a financial advisor can help you determine the appropriate risk level for your pension investments.

4. Plan for Inflation
Inflation erodes the purchasing power of your money over time, so it’s essential to factor it into your pension investment strategy. Investing in assets that offer protection against inflation, such as stocks or real estate, can help safeguard your retirement funds against rising prices. Consider how inflation will impact your standard of living during retirement and adjust your investment strategy accordingly.

5. Reassess Your Investment Strategy Regularly
As you move closer to retirement, it’s important to reassess your pension investment strategy regularly. Consider shifting your portfolio towards more conservative investments to protect your savings as you approach retirement age. Monitor the performance of your investments, review your financial goals, and make any necessary adjustments to ensure your pension funds are on track to meet your retirement needs.

6. Seek Professional Advice
Investing your pension funds can be complex, especially if you’re not well-versed in financial markets. Seeking advice from a qualified financial advisor can help you make informed decisions about your investments and create a tailored strategy that aligns with your retirement goals. A professional can offer personalized guidance, assess your risk tolerance, and provide recommendations on how to optimize your pension funds for long-term growth.

7. Stay Informed and Educated
Financial markets are constantly evolving, so it’s essential to stay informed and educated about investment trends and opportunities. Take the time to research and understand the different investment options available to you, and stay updated on economic developments that may impact your pension funds. The more knowledge you have about investing, the better equipped you’ll be to make informed decisions about your retirement savings.
